Fan-out backpressure for the Quillet notifier: when the queue depth crosses the soft limit, the dispatcher sheds low-priority pushes and batches the rest at 500ms intervals. Reviewer should confirm the shed counter is exported and that retries respect the jitter window. Once merged, the release artifact gets re-signed by the pipeline, which expects the deploy key shown below.

deploy key for bawep-yawif: bky6_GQhaSt

Internal Memo – Vendale Instruments

To the finance team: procurement has shortlisted three candidates in the second-source search for the Lumex sensor housing, following the supply disruption at our primary vendor. Qualification trials begin next month, with tooling costs estimated within the contingency already reserved. Please prepare payment terms comparisons for each candidate ahead of the selection meeting. The confidential note on business plans is appended directly below.

management briefing: Only 5 of the 80 pilot accounts renewed Zorix, so a churn review is set for October 1.

### Runbook: BounceBroom — Account Recovery

If the BounceBroom email bounce processor loses access to its service account, do not create a new one. First, pause the intake queue so bounces buffer safely. Then open the recovery console and select the BounceBroom principal. Verification requires approval from the on-call lead. Once approved, the console prompts for the stored recovery credentials; enter the passphrase that appears directly below this paragraph.

recovery phrase for fahof-kahap: holion-gormir-jorix-istix-briwyn-sorael